Transaction 28581192410f20a8fe5d17ba6cd4e40a128f0df76103e4cff3d15279ddd985cb
1 Input
1 Output
-
28581192410f20a8fe5d17ba6cd4e40a128f0df76103e4cff3d15279ddd985cb:0
- value
- 257888
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68bc7f4e4d7f6f330ada6ad988d8bce640591071 OP_EQUAL
- address
- 3BEp1WqqCcwfrkKoCfetPZqa363JaL1u8w